Frequently Asked Questions About ZIP Code 27403

27403 ZIP Code FAQs and quick facts

See frequently asked questions about 27403 (Greensboro, NC)

1

What region of the U.S. is ZIP Code 27403 associated with?

The 27403 ZIP Code is primarily associated with Greensboro, NC in the United States.
2

What U.S. county is ZIP Code 27403 located in?

The 27403 ZIP Code is located in Guilford County in the state of North Carolina.
3

What is the current population estimate for ZIP Code 27403?

The ZIP Code 27403 has a current population estimate of 22,867, according to the U.S. Census Bureau.
4

What is the median income in ZIP Code 27403?

The median household income in ZIP Code 27403 is $50,000, while the mean household income in the region is $66,354.

What is the per capita income in ZIP Code 27403?

The per capita income in ZIP Code 27403 of $23,894 is approximately 29.94% less than the per capita income in the U.S. overall of $34,103.

What income range is most common for those living in ZIP Code 27403?

An estimated 19.9% of the residents in 27403 earn $50,000 to $74,999 per year, the highest percentage of any range, while 13.4% earn $35,000 to $49,999 per year.

Are any residents of ZIP Code 27403 living below the poverty line?

An estimated 16.3% of the population is living below the poverty line in this region. This rate is approximately71.58% higher than the overall poverty rate in the U.S. of 9.5%.
8

When were most homes built in ZIP Code 27403?

Approximately 22.2% of homes in ZIP Code 27403 were built in 1939 or earlier. This is, relatively speaking, the largest of percentage of any time range. Additionally, 21.4% of homes in the region were built between 1950 and 1959.

How many residents in ZIP Code 27403 are high school graduates?

In ZIP Code 27403, 91.1% of the population graduated high school. In this region, 3.0% achieved an education level less than 9th grade, while 5.9% attended 9th to 12th grade, but did not receive a diploma.

How many residents in ZIP Code 27403 are college graduates?

In ZIP Code 27403, 43.7% of the population has a Bachelor's degree or higher. An estimated 19.8% attended some college, but did not receive a degree.

What is the highest level of education attained for the typical resident in ZIP Code 27403?

An estimated 25.3% of the residents in 27403 reached the level of bachelor's degree, the highest percentage of any level. Additionally, 20.0% reached the level of high school graduate (includes equivalency).

What is the most frequent language spoken in home in ZIP Code 27403?

In ZIP Code 27403, approximately 89.1% of the population in 27403 list "English only" as the language spoken in home. This is the most common in-home language spoken in the region.

Other than English, what is the most common language spoken in home in the 27403 ZIP Code?

An estimated 4.8% of residents in ZIP Code 27403 speak Spanish at home. This is the most common language spoken in home, other than English.

Are there more females or males in ZIP Code 27403?

There are more females than males in ZIP Code 27403. Females comprise approximately 54.5% of the population, while males make up an estimated 45.5%.
15

What is the racial composition of ZIP Code 27403?

The most common race in 27403 (race alone or in combination with one or more other races), is White (63.7%), followed by Black or African American (30.4%) . In this region, 98.0% of residents are one race, while 2.0% are two or more races.

What is the average age of residents in ZIP Code 27403?

Residents of ZIP Code 27403 have a median age of 26.2 years. People aged 20 to 24 years make up approximately 21.0% of the population in 27403, the largest percentage of any age group.

Is the population in ZIP Code 27403 older or younger than average?

Residents of ZIP Code 27403 are younger than average. The median age of 26.2 years in ZIP Code 27403 is approximately 31.23% lower than the overall median age in the U.S. of 38.1 years.

How many people in ZIP Code 27403 do not have health insurance?

Approximately 12.7% of adults aged 18 to 64 in ZIP Code 27403 are uninsured and do not have health insurance.
19

What portion of the population in ZIP Code 27403 is of voting age?

According to U.S. Census Bureau data, approximately 87% of residents in the 27403 ZIP Code are in the voting age population (18 and over).
20

How many residents in ZIP Code 27403 are senior citizens?

An estimated 12.4% of residents in ZIP Code 27403 are of age 62 years and older.

What job industry do residents of ZIP Code 27403 work in most frequently?

An estimated 25.7% of the employed population 16 years and over in ZIP Code 27403 work in educational services, and health care and social assistance. This is the largest percentage of any job industry.

Which area codes are associated with ZIP Code 27403?

Telephone area codes that are frequently associated with ZIP Code 27403 include: 336, and 743.
23

How common is broadband Internet service in ZIP Code 27403?

An estimated 79.4% of households in ZIP Code 27403 have broadband Internet service. Approximately 91.5% of households in the region have a computer in home.
24

Does ZIP Code 27403 have good solar power potential?

The 27403 ZIP Code has above average solar power potential when compared to the U.S. as a whole. This region's average solar radiation level of 5.32kWh/m2/day is 7.47% greater than the overall U.S. daily average.
